5 U.S. Code § 8105: Total disability

5 U.S. Code § 8105

5 U.S. Code § 8105 is about Total disability. It is under Subchapter I (Generally) of Chapter 81 (Compensation For Work Injuries) of Subpart G (Insurance And Annuities) of Part III (Employees) of Title 5 (Government Organizations and Employees) of the Code.

(a) If the disability is total, the United States shall pay the employee during the disability monthly monetary compensation equal to 66⅔ percent of his monthly pay, which is known as his basic compensation for total disability.



(b) The loss of use of both hands, both arms, both feet, or both legs, or the loss of sight of both eyes, is prima facie permanent total disability.
